Abstract

L'invention concerne un capteur électrochimique. Le capteur est monté sur la pointe d'un cathéter 1 en polychlorure de vinyle et comprend une électrode 2 en verre de mesure de pH, sensible au gaz carbonique, et une électrode 3 sous forme de fil d'argent qui réduit électrochimiquement l'oxygène. Les électrodes 2 et 3 sont associées à une électrode de référence 4 en argent/chlorure d'argent. Le capteur comporte un électrolyte 5 formé de bicarbonate de sodium/chlorure de sodium, qui est revêtu d'une membrane 6 en polystyrène perméable à l'oxygène, au gaz carbonique et à l'eau. Le capteur est destiné à la mesure continue et simultanée des pressions partielles de l'oxygène et du gaz carbonique dans le sang.
